noel 2003/01/10 13:28:49
Modified: src/java/org/apache/james/nntpserver Tag: branch_2_1_fcs
NNTPHandler.java
Log:
If the NNTP connection has idled out, the socket will already be closed.
Revision Changes Path
No revision
No revision
1.25.4.2 +4 -2
jakarta-james/src/java/org/apache/james/nntpserver/NNTPHandler.java
Index: NNTPHandler.java
===================================================================
RCS file:
/home/cvs/jakarta-james/src/java/org/apache/james/nntpserver/NNTPHandler.java,v
retrieving revision 1.25.4.1
retrieving revision 1.25.4.2
diff -u -r1.25.4.1 -r1.25.4.2
--- NNTPHandler.java 10 Jan 2003 08:30:15 -0000 1.25.4.1
+++ NNTPHandler.java 10 Jan 2003 21:28:49 -0000 1.25.4.2
@@ -361,8 +361,10 @@
getLogger().info("Connection closed");
} catch (Exception e) {
- doQUIT(null);
- getLogger().error( "Exception during connection:" + e.getMessage(), e );
+ if (!(socket == null || socket.isClosed())) {
+ doQUIT(null);
+ getLogger().error( "Exception during connection:" + e.getMessage(),
e );
+ }
} finally {
resetHandler();
}
--
To unsubscribe, e-mail: <mailto:[EMAIL PROTECTED]>
For additional commands, e-mail: <mailto:[EMAIL PROTECTED]>